About the Author

Dolores Allen …The Author was born in eastern Canada. Her childhood ended at age of 9 ½, when her father died in a house fire. She has learned much from her own life altering experiences. She writes about real people. Dolores gives credit for her talent of storytelling to her father.

She lived most of her adult life in Windsor, Ontario.

After being a Real Estate Broker for 26 years, she attended the University of Windsor, studying writing.

She has published stories in a weekly newspaper and is currently writing for a local paper in the Maritimes.

She incorporates personal tragedies into many of her fiction stories.

Life experiences and losses have given a vast vessel for story telling. Her words are inspiring and emit courage.

The variety of stories hold your interest. She has a creative imagination.

In the year 2000 she attended a school reunion back east, which was the beginning of a wonderful loving relationship with George.

They were married in 2002 and now reside in Green Valley, Arizona for the winter months.
